What moves through the night
Arriving. A grounding ritual to help you land — ocean in view, feet on the ground, nowhere else to be.
Cacao. A ceremonial cup to warm the chest and hold your intention for the evening.
Movement. A guided somatic journey through your inner landscape. Slow, intuitive, always in choice. Nothing forced, nothing performed.
Breath. Gentle and settling. Enough to bring you further in, never enough to push you out.
Drum. Rhythm older than language. Something the body recognises long before the mind catches up.
Sound. Tibetan bowl and voice, held over you while you rest.
Stillness. Time to let it settle. The integration is not an afterthought — it is the work.
Circle. The medicine of sitting with sisters. To speak, to be witnessed, to be met in your full human truth without anyone reaching to fix you.

Before you book
You'll be asked a few short questions when you register. They help me hold the space well and make sure the evening is right for you. If anything in your answers means this isn't the right circle for you right now, I'll be in touch personally.
Cacao is a mild stimulant. If you're pregnant, taking antidepressants or heart medication, or you'd simply rather not, let me know when you book and there'll be a warm herbal alternative waiting for you.
This circle is somatic education and facilitation. It is not therapy, and it is not a substitute for medical or psychological care.
